Recognizing the Role of an Earnings and Partnerships Leader.
A Profits and Collaborations Leader is in charge of making the most of company growth by developing earnings methods while developing useful partnerships with clients, vendors, modern technology carriers, suppliers, and strategic organizations. The function combines commercial leadership with relationship administration, requiring both logical thinking and remarkable social abilities. Michael Lienert
Unlike conventional sales execs whose duties may focus primarily on closing offers, Earnings and Partnerships Leaders take a more comprehensive point of view. They recognize brand-new markets, work out tactical partnerships, maximize revenue streams, improve customer life time worth, and make sure that collaborations create common worth for all stakeholders.
Their obligations frequently consist of:
Creating revenue growth techniques lined up with corporate goals.
Structure lasting strategic collaborations.
Bargaining business arrangements.
Determining brand-new market opportunities.
Working together across sales, marketing, finance, and item groups.
Determining partnership efficiency with key efficiency indications (KPIs).
Leading cross-functional initiatives that increase organization growth.
This mix of calculated preparation and implementation makes the duty significantly important across technology firms, SaaS services, health care organizations, financial institutions, manufacturing companies, and specialist solutions.
Why Profits Management Is Developing
Modern buyers expect incorporated solutions rather than isolated products. Companies now compete through environments where several companies team up to supply greater customer value. Consequently, collaborations have become a significant resource of development and revenue generation.
Strategic partnerships can consist of:
Modern technology integrations
Channel partnerships
Associate programs
Joint endeavors
Recommendation networks
Circulation agreements
Co-marketing campaigns
Strategic investments
An Income and Partnerships Leader assesses which relationships generate quantifiable company end results and spends sources accordingly. This strategic strategy reduces consumer acquisition costs, broadens market reach, and reinforces brand name integrity.
Organizations that efficiently build collaboration ecological communities often experience sped up development due to the fact that companions present brand-new customers, boost product offerings, and produce opportunities that would certainly be hard to accomplish independently.
Crucial Abilities for Success
Successful Profits and Collaborations Leaders incorporate commercial proficiency with leadership capabilities. They possess solid logical abilities to analyze revenue information while maintaining the emotional knowledge required to cultivate lasting partnerships.
Some of one of the most beneficial competencies consist of:
Strategic Thinking
Leaders should anticipate market patterns, assess competitive landscapes, and identify possibilities prior to competitors do. Long-term preparation allows lasting growth rather than temporary earnings spikes.
Negotiation
Partnership arrangements require careful arrangement to make certain common advantage. Strong negotiators balance financial goals with partnership building.
Data-Driven Choice Making
Earnings optimization relies on metrics such as customer procurement cost (CAC), client life time value (CLV), yearly persisting profits (ARR), churn price, conversion prices, and collaboration ROI. Leaders utilize these insights to improve strategy continuously.
Interaction
Earnings campaigns include several departments. Reliable communication makes sure alignment amongst executive management, advertising, sales, finance, product development, and outside partners.
Leadership
High-performing groups call for clear direction, coaching, liability, and a culture of cooperation. Revenue leaders motivate cross-functional teams to pursue usual goals.

Determining Success
Success in this management role expands beyond complete income. Modern organizations assess multiple efficiency indications to recognize lasting growth.
Usual metrics include:
Revenue development price
Gross profit
Consumer retention
Customer life time value
Partner-generated earnings
Ordinary bargain dimension
Sales cycle length
Companion contentment
Revival rates
Market expansion
Balanced dimension guarantees leaders focus on lucrative, lasting development rather than concentrating solely on temporary sales numbers.
